Output 8fbf832944bc7791e83fce5a2dfc2faf34f7442589e2a95e7e4e8de781993113:0

value
1210000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e15e73566c4758236751d8ed567a79d6284e4548 OP_EQUAL
address
3NEf7F732V7Dg3sSsUpT42kbae54zo2VG3
transaction
8fbf832944bc7791e83fce5a2dfc2faf34f7442589e2a95e7e4e8de781993113
confirmations
388810
spent
true